CTL_CODE:用于创建一个唯一的32位系统I/O控制代码,这个控制代码包括4部分
组成:DeviceType(设备类型,高16位(16-31位)),Access(访问限制,14-15位),Function(功能2-13
位),Method(I/O访问内存使用方式)。
This macro creates a unique system I/O control code (IOCTL).
#define CTL_CODE(DeviceType, Function, Method, Access) ( ((DeviceType) << 16) | ((Access) << 14) | ((Function) << 2) | (Method) )
Parameters(参数)
DeviceTypeDefines the type of device for the given IOCTL.
This parameter can be no bigger than a WORD value.
The values used by Microsoft are in the range 0-32767; the values 32768-65535 are reserved for use by OEMs and IHVs.

Function
Defines an action within the device category.
Function codes 0-2047 are reserved for Microsoft; codes 2048-4095 are reserved for OEMs and IHVs.
A function code can be no larger then 4095.
Method
Defines the method codes for how buffers are passed for I/O and file system controls.
The following values are possible for this parameter:
METHOD_BUFFERED
METHOD_IN_DIRECT
METHOD_OUT_DIRECT
METHOD_NEITHER
This field is ignored by Windows CE. You should always use the
METHOD_BUFFERED value unless compatibility with Windows-based desktop
platforms is required using a different Method
value.
Access
Defines the access check value for any access.
The following table shows the possible flags for this parameter. The FILE_ACCESS_ANY is generally the correct value.
Flag | Description |
---|---|
FILE_ANY_ACCESS | Request all access. |
FILE_READ_ACCESS | Request read access. Can be used with FILE_WRITE_ACCESS. |
FILE_WRITE_ACCESS | Request write access. Can be used with FILE_READ_ACCESS. |
Return Values(返回值)
None.Remarks(备注)
The macro can be used for defining IOCTL and FSCTL function controlcodes. All IOCTLs must be defined this way to ensure that values used
by Microsoft, OEMs, and IHVs do not overlap.
